Forrester rates client security suites
Forrester Research issued a report on client security suites on Wednesday, giving McAfee top billing as market leader. Security vendors were evaluated based on their ability to provide protection against known threats and the comprehensiveness of their offerings--such as antivirus, anti-spyware, personal firewall and host intrusion prevention systems, or IPS.
McAfee received the highest rating, although its host IPS functionality is not yet fully integrated. Symantec offered "strong spyware detection" and management features, said the report, but limited host IPS functionality. Trend Micro excelled in a unified architecture and Computer Associates was cited for the "best protection against known threats," but neither company received accolades in any of the other areas that were evaluated.
